Requirements of 20' Shipping Containers
The 20' shipping container is a standard unit in the shipping industry, specifically due to its capacity and transportability. Here's a detailed breakdown of its specifications:
SpecificationInformationLength20 feet (6.058 meters)Width8 feet (2.438 meters)Height8.5 feet (2.591 meters)Interior Length19.4 feet (5.89 meters)Interior Width7.7 feet (2.35 meters)Interior Height7.9 feet (2.39 meters)Weight4,800 pounds (2,200 kg)Maximum Payload48,000 lbs (21,600 kg)Volume1,169 cubic feet (33.2 m THREE)
These specifications make the 20' shipping container a flexible alternative because it offers significant cargo capacity while remaining manageable in size.
Advantages of 20' Shipping Containers
Economical: Compared to larger containers, a 20' container typically costs less, which makes it an appealing alternative for little organizations or specific projects.
Adaptability: Whether for shipping, storage, or conversion into a livable area, a 20' container fits a large range of applications.
Mobility: Easy to move and transport, the 20' container can be transferred with standard shipping techniques, enhancing its functionality for businesses and personal use.
Resilience: Constructed from robust materials created to endure extreme conditions, these containers are resistant to weather, insects, and basic wear and tear.
Space Optimization: Despite being smaller than other shipping containers, the 20' option supplies a reliable solution for city environments where space may be restricted.
Typical Uses for 20' Shipping Containers1. Shipping and Transportation
The main usage of a 20' shipping container remains the transportation of products throughout land and sea. They can bring various items, from equipment to consumer products.
2. Storage Solutions
Due to their sturdiness and security, these containers can work as reliable short-lived or long-term storage solutions for individual, business, or commercial use.
3. Residential Conversions
Lots of creative individuals and designers have actually turned shipping containers into small homes, galleries, or holiday rentals. The 20' container is especially appealing for those trying to find minimalist living options.
4. Temporary Offices
In building and construction websites or during occasion setups, 20' containers can quickly be transformed into workplace or conference room, supplying a practical service away from the main facilities.
5. Mobile Shops or Restaurants
With a little creativity, entrepreneurs can transform 20' containers into cafes, pop-up shops, or food trucks, making the most of low overhead costs while preserving movement.
6. Workshops
For tradespeople or craft enthusiasts, a 20' container can be modified into a workshop, providing adequate work space without the need for expensive realty.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)1. How much can a 20-foot shipping container hold?
A 20-foot shipping container can carry a maximum payload of around 48,000 pounds (21,600 kg), depending upon the container type and condition.
2. What are the dimensions of a 20' shipping container?
The outside dimensions of a standard 20-foot container are 20' in length, 8' in width, and 8.5' in height. The interior dimensions a little vary due to the container walls, measuring around 19.4' in length, 7.7' in width, and 7.9' in height.
3. Can I tailor a shipping container?
Yes, numerous companies provide personalization alternatives, permitting you to add windows, doors, insulation, electrical systems, and pipes to meet particular needs.

5. What is the life expectancy of a 20-foot shipping container?
With proper maintenance, a shipping container can last around 25 years or longer. Regular assessments and care can substantially extend its lifespan.
